Actually, I don't have a green... it is a blue on mine... that or the color has changed. That one really doesn't matter though, it's the 360 slot signal. The only 3 that matter are Black, Red and White.

I don't believe Nissan would change from 12V to 5V, so I think that is a 12V power (red wire). The black is ground, and White is 4 slot signal. The only question in my mind is how the signal reads. I believe the signal square wavelength STARTS (the rising part of the square wave) at whatever the advance is on the dizzy. In my case it's 20deg BTDC, but you can change that to whatever yours is. I still have to verify this (Or if anyone else can tell me what their nissan opto wheel is...)

Has everyone else just fed that signal wire to MSEFI without any probs?

And I'm 99.9% sure that the white is the signal we're looking for (I'm also working on a 89 240sx). The only way I could be wrong is if we're looking at different dizzy's, which from what I've found there are two different types that were used, but I'm thinking that was for the KA24DE 240sx's...
